Position Summary – The Vice President of Academic Affairs (VPAA) serves as the Chief Academic Affairs officer of the College, responsible for the academic enterprise, policy, and procedures. The VPAA sets the vision and leads the division in pursuit of teaching excellence and student success. Essential Functions Teaching Excellence Serves as the Cabinet Lead for the Teaching Excellence strategic theme. Assists in defining the theme and aligning it to the College mission. Appoints project leads and holds periodic meetings with leaders. Monitors progress and provides campus updates. Advances teaching excellence and student learning through collaboration. Demonstrates commitment to evidence‑based practice by using data to make decisions. Holistic Student Support Leads the College’s Strategic Enrollment Management work. Develops an academic schedule that facilitates student completion and success. Collaborates with other division vice presidents to support student success. Program Innovation Creates innovative programs responsive to educational and workforce changes. Establishes connections to workforce and education leaders. Seeks alternate funding sources to strengthen teaching, learning and outcomes. Fiscal Stewardship Responsible fiscal stewardship of the Academic Affairs Division funds. Leads development of division budgets aligned with College priorities. Ensures investments in faculty release time reflect strategic priorities. Ensures the academic schedule and enrollment maximize resources. Organizational Culture Provides leadership that aligns with College values. Sets vision for professional development of faculty and staff. Sets expectations and accountability measures. Facilitates effective processes engaging academic leaders and faculty. Leads policy review and development aligned with laws and TBR guidelines. Knowledge, Skills and Work Characteristics Ability to lead in a manner that reflects the values. Proficient communication with multiple audiences. High emotional intelligence. Strategic thinking and collaborative decision making. Builds strategic partnerships internally and externally. Uses data to inform decision‑making. Adapts quickly to change and communicates the “why”. Commits to continuous improvement and PDCA cycle. Qualifications Doctoral degree from a regionally accredited institution, 5‑7 years of teaching experience in higher education. Significant, increasingly responsible leadership experience in a college setting with demonstrated change leadership. Salary Range: $120,659 – $156,856 Open until filled: no #J-18808-Ljbffr
